IPL franchise Rajasthan Royals (RR) took to their Twitter account and shared a video of English cricketer Jos Buttler getting help from his adorable daughter during a workout session.

Rajasthan Royals will start their IPL 2021 campaign against Punjab Kings (PBKS) on 12th April in Mumbai. Sanju Samson led franchise will be keen to bounce back in this year's tournament after having a forgettable IPL 2020, where they finished last on the points table. 

With only three days remaining for IPL 14 the preparations for the tournament are in full flow as the players who have completed their quarantine are sweating it out outdoors while those who are still in quarantine exercising inside their team hotel rooms.

Talking to their official Twitter handle, Rajasthan Royals shared a video of Jos Buttler working out with his daughter Georgia Rose. In the video, the right-handed-batsman is seen performing exercises with his daughter in his hands.

The little one also makes a genuine attempt to copy some of her dad's training routine. RR shared the video with the caption, “ BRB, melting,” 

Jos Buttler has been in India since the start of white-ball leg between India and England. The 30-year-old also captained the visitors in the last two ODIs after regular skipper Eoin Morgan was ruled out due to injury. 

The premier English batsman had below-par performance in IPL 2020 as the swashbuckling batsman scored 328 runs in 13 matches at a strike rate of 144.49 with two fifties.
